Output f64db8038d596b7eaebc46bd1c49741e3f241825efc0cea67d2d4a5094bef40e:0

value
154330
script pubkey
OP_0 OP_PUSHBYTES_20 efc2b8622df1714affef53f6e5b3e36f6994abcf
address
bc1qalptsc3d79c54ll020mwtvlrda5ef270463ujl
transaction
f64db8038d596b7eaebc46bd1c49741e3f241825efc0cea67d2d4a5094bef40e
confirmations
189567
spent
true